Here are four things to know:
1. Most recently, Mr. Smith served as national service line administrator for cardiac and vascular services at Dallas-based Tenet Healthcare.
2. He previously served as COO of Delray Medical Center in Delray Beach, Fla.
3. He has 23-plus years of healthcare experience and began his career at Deloitte, where he worked with numerous hospitals.
4. He holds a master of science degree in taxation from the University of Miami and is a certified public accountant in Florida.
